Operational Support Specialist Overview:
Under direct supervision, this role performs routine but varied clerical and administrative duties in accordance with established procedures The position supports document and data management operations by handling tasks such as data entry, document processing, and records maintenance The individual will apply knowledge of departmental procedures and maintain a general understanding of cross-functional operations to ensure accurate and timely completion of tasks This role requires attention to detail, the ability to manage repetitive work efficiently, and the capability to resolve routine issues independently while escalating complex concerns when necessary The position contributes to overall operational efficiency by ensuring data accuracy, proper document handling, and effective coordination with internal teams
Job Duties:
Perform data entry and maintain accurate records Scan, file, and organize documents Photocopy and compile records Tabulate and post information as required Distribute outgoing mail Coordinate with print services Verify information and resolve routine discrepancies Retrieve and route documents to appropriate departments Provide administrative and clerical support Conduct basic research using internal and external sources
